BENIN – A NEW bishop, Rt. Rev. Augustine Ehijimentor Ohilebo was weekend conscecrated for the Diocese of Sabongida-Ora, Church of Nigeria, (Anglican Communion).
The enthronement which held at St. John’s Anglican Cathedral was performed by the Archbishop of Anglican Province of Bendel, Most Rev. Friday Imaekhai, on behalf of the Anglican Primate, Most Rev. Nicholas Okoh.
Rev. Ohilebo was ordained in 2004 before he proceeded to the Ambrose Alli University, Ekpoma where he studied Religious Management and Cultural Studies.
He is the third bishop of Sabongi-da-Ora diocese.
Bishop Ohilebo, speaking shortly after his ordination, pledged to consolidate on the achievements of his predecessors, warning clergymen in the Diocese against laziness and lukewarm attitude in the discharge of priestly responsibilities.
The new bishop also pledged to revive the diocese’s cassava processing and pure water factories, and establish a printing press from the set of printing machines donated to the diocese.
His words, “Our administration shall be committed to the revamping of these structures. We should be ready to give up anything if God ask us to do so.”
